Schlumbergerites

Holothuroidea - Dendrochirotida - Schlumbergeritidae

Taxonomy
Schlumbergerites was named by Deflandre-Rigaud (1962). It is considered to be a form taxon. Its type is Schlumbergerites sievertsae. It is the type genus of Schlumbergeritidae.

It was assigned to Schlumbergeritidae by Deflandre-Rigaud (1962), Frizzell and Exline (1966), Zawidzka (1971); and to Dendrochirotida by Sepkoski (2002).
